Research summary


The generation of carbon waste and wastewater are unavoidable consequences of human activity. But managing these processes sustainably, and supporting efforts to decarbonize the associated infrastructure, are crucial for mitigating climate change. As Canada Research Chair in Microbial Electrocatalysis for Energy and Environment, Dr. Bipro Dhar is working to come up with ways to do this.

He and his research team are applying unique electroactive microbes with electron harvesting and transporting features to engineer more robust, efficient anaerobic biotechnologies that can boost the conversion of carbon waste into pipeline-quality biogas, green hydrogen, and medium-chain carboxylates. They are using multifaceted approaches that combine process engineering, molecular biology, and modelling tools to develop new scientific knowledge and innovative engineering strategies. Ultimately, their work will support the waste and wastewater sectors’ transition to the circular economy.
